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-16640

Long running queries on the secondary with WT

    • Type: Icon: Task Task
    • Resolution: Done
    • Priority: Icon: Major - P3 Major - P3
    • 2.8.0-rc5
    • Affects Version/s: None
    • Component/s: Replication
    • None
    • Fully Compatible

      We have disabled yielding with WT, because it is not necessary due to the use of snapshots.

      On secondaries though, because of the way the Parallel Batch Writer lock is implemented, it is possible that a long running query would prevent the log applier threads from starting until it is completed and thus cause backlog.

      This ticket is to verify this behaviour and if it turns out to be true to figure out a solution.

            Assignee:
            kaloian.manassiev@mongodb.com Kaloian Manassiev
            Reporter:
            kaloian.manassiev@mongodb.com Kaloian Manassiev
            Votes:
            0 Vote for this issue
            Watchers:
            9 Start watching this issue

              Created:
              Updated:
              Resolved: